About Roberto Kelly

  • Roberto Conrado "Gray" Kelly (born October 1, 1964) is a Panamanian former professional baseball outfielder in Major League Baseball and current manager of the Sultanes de Monterrey of the Mexican Baseball League.
  • He was signed by the New York Yankees as an amateur free agent in 1982 and went on to play for them (1987–1992 and 2000), the Cincinnati Reds (1993–1994), Atlanta Braves (1994), Montreal Expos (1995), Los Angeles Dodgers (1995), Minnesota Twins (1996–1997), Seattle Mariners (1997) and Texas Rangers (1998–1999).
  • During his playing days in Panama, he was known as La Sombra, Spanish for Shadow.
  • After his playing career, he managed the Giants' single-A team, the Augusta GreenJackets and later became a coach for the Giants major league team.
